Written Answers. - House Prices.

Billy Timmins

Question:

345 Mr. Timmins asked the Minister for the Environment and Local Government the average price of a new and second hand house for a first time buyer in June 1997, June 1998, June 1999 and June 2000 as per his Department's statistics;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[22383/00]

While my Department does not publish definitive information on the average house price paid by first time buyers, analysis of house purchase loan survey data available to my Department indicates that typical first time buyer prices are generally around 25-30% below the overall average house price. The survey, which includes information on about 30% of all mortgage based housing transactions, reveals the following trends in national average house prices purchased by first time buyers:

National Average House Price Paid by First Time Buyers (FTBs) Annually

New FTB Houses

Second hand FTB Houses

1997

£74,500

£73,600

1998

£81,500

£78,200

1999

£99,600

£102,700

2000 (first six months)

£110,700

£111,400
